Lagos State Govt Seals Off Establishments for Environmental Violations

The Lagos State Environmental Protection Agency (LASEPA) has sealed off several establishments for violating the state’s environmental laws in the Lekki Phase I area of the state.

According to a post shared on X.com by the state Commissioner, Ministry of Environment and Water Resources, Tokunbo Wahab, the affected establishments, including Kingfisher, Red Lagos, Logic Church, and Bolivar, were found to be non-compliant with environmental laws despite prior warnings.

Wahab stressed that LASEPA’s action is part of its efforts to uphold environmental regulations and combat noise pollution. He wrote, “This proactive measure by LASEPA underscores its commitment to fostering a serene and sustainable environment that prioritizes cleanliness, safety, and environmental responsibility.”

This development comes months after the Lagos State Government also sealed off Landcraft Industries Nigeria and Word of Light Christ Ministry (Camp of Light) for noise and environmental pollution-related offenses.
